The Unseen Ingredient: Understanding Pesticide Residues

Before diving into avoidance strategies, it’s crucial to understand what we’re up against. Pesticides are chemical or biological agents used to control pests that can harm agricultural crops. While regulations aim to limit residues on harvested produce, complete elimination is rarely achievable. These residues can persist on the surface, within the skin, and sometimes even penetrate the flesh of fruits and vegetables.

The potential health effects of pesticide exposure are a subject of ongoing scientific research. Concerns range from acute symptoms like nausea and headaches to long-term issues, including neurological problems, hormonal disruption, and an increased risk of certain cancers. Children and pregnant women are often considered more vulnerable due to their developing systems. Prioritize Organic: The Gold Standard (with Nuances)

Opting for organic produce is widely considered the most direct way to reduce pesticide intake. Organic farming prohibits the use of most synthetic pesticides, herbicides, and fertilizers. When you see the “organic” label, it signifies adherence to stringent standards designed to minimize chemical intervention.

  • Concrete Example: Instead of conventional apples, which are frequently found on “dirty dozen” lists, choose organic apples. Similarly, for leafy greens like spinach and kale, which have large surface areas to accumulate residues, organic varieties offer a significant advantage.

  • Actionable Explanation: Look for USDA Organic certification (or your country’s equivalent) on packaging. Understand that “organic” doesn’t mean “pesticide-free” – natural pesticides are permitted, and cross-contamination can occur – but it drastically reduces the overall chemical load compared to conventionally grown produce. Make organic your default for items you consume frequently or in large quantities, especially those with thin skins or that are eaten raw.

Embrace the “Dirty Dozen” and “Clean Fifteen”

Two lists, compiled annually by the Environmental Working Group (EWG), serve as invaluable tools for prioritizing organic purchases.

  • The “Dirty Dozen”: These are fruits and vegetables found to have the highest pesticide residues in conventional farming. Focusing your organic budget on these items offers the most significant impact.

  • Concrete Example (Dirty Dozen): Strawberries, spinach, kale, grapes, peaches, pears, nectarines, apples, bell and hot peppers, cherries, blueberries, and green beans often top this list. For these, always aim for organic if possible.

  • The “Clean Fifteen”: Conversely, these fruits and vegetables typically have the lowest pesticide residues, making conventional options a more acceptable choice if organic isn’t available or budget-friendly.

  • Concrete Example (Clean Fifteen): Avocados, sweet corn, pineapple, onions, papayas, sweet peas (frozen), asparagus, honeydew melon, kiwis, cabbage, mushrooms, mangoes, watermelon, eggplant, and sweet potatoes are consistently low in residues. You can often confidently buy conventional versions of these.

  • Actionable Explanation: Print out or save these lists on your phone. Refer to them while grocery shopping. They empower you to make informed decisions without needing to buy everything organic, which can be cost-prohibitive for many. Prioritize organic for the Dirty Dozen, and feel less pressured for the Clean Fifteen.

The Art of Washing: Beyond a Simple Rinse

Washing produce is often underestimated, but it’s a critical step in removing surface pesticide residues. A simple rinse under running water isn’t always enough.

  • Running Water and Friction:
    • Concrete Example: For firm produce like apples, potatoes, or bell peppers, scrub them vigorously under cold running water using a produce brush. This physical friction helps dislodge residues from the skin.

    • Actionable Explanation: Don’t just hold the item under the faucet; actively rub and scrub. The mechanical action is key.

  • Soaking Methods:

    • Baking Soda Solution:
      • Concrete Example: For leafy greens, berries, or items with irregular surfaces where residues can hide, prepare a solution of 1 teaspoon of baking soda per 2 cups of water. Submerge the produce for 12-15 minutes, then rinse thoroughly under running water. Studies have shown baking soda to be effective at breaking down some surface pesticides.

      • Actionable Explanation: The alkalinity of baking soda helps neutralize acidic pesticides and dislodge them from the surface. Ensure a thorough final rinse to remove any baking soda residue.

    • Saltwater Solution:

      • Concrete Example: For items like grapes or broccoli, a saltwater solution (1 tablespoon of salt per cup of water) can be effective. Soak for a few minutes, then rinse well.

      • Actionable Explanation: Salt can help draw out impurities, including some pesticide residues. However, it’s less researched for pesticide removal than baking soda. Always rinse completely to avoid a salty taste.

    • Vinegar Solution (Diluted):

      • Concrete Example: A solution of one part white vinegar to four parts water can be used for a quick soak (5-10 minutes) for produce like berries or spinach.

      • Actionable Explanation: Vinegar’s acidity can help kill some bacteria and may aid in dislodging certain residues. However, it’s not universally proven to be superior to water or baking soda for pesticide removal. Always rinse well to prevent a vinegary taste.

  • Drying:

    • Concrete Example: After washing, thoroughly dry produce with a clean cloth or paper towel. This not only prevents spoilage but can also remove any lingering residues that were dislodged but not rinsed away.

    • Actionable Explanation: Don’t skip this step. It’s the final mechanical action that helps ensure maximum removal.

The Power of Peeling: A Strategic Sacrifice

For many fruits and vegetables, a significant portion of pesticide residues resides on or just beneath the skin. Peeling, while sacrificing some nutrients, is a highly effective way to reduce exposure.

  • Concrete Example: Potatoes, carrots, cucumbers, apples, and pears (when not organic) are prime candidates for peeling. Even if you usually eat the skin, consider peeling these if they are conventionally grown.

  • Actionable Explanation: Understand that you’ll lose some fiber and nutrients concentrated in the skin. Weigh this against your concern about pesticide exposure. For items like carrots, where the skin is thin and easily peeled, the nutrient loss is minimal compared to the pesticide reduction benefit. For apples, if you prefer not to peel, ensure rigorous washing with a produce brush.

Trimming and Discarding Outer Leaves: Targeted Removal

For leafy vegetables, the outermost leaves are often the most exposed to pesticides and can accumulate higher concentrations.

  • Concrete Example: For cabbage, lettuce, and kale, remove and discard the outer two to three layers of leaves. For broccoli and cauliflower, trim off the florets and discard the tough, exposed stems.

  • Actionable Explanation: This simple step directly removes the parts of the plant most likely to have come into contact with sprays. It’s a quick and effective way to reduce your intake.

Cooking Methods and Their Impact: Heat as a Helper

While washing and peeling are primary, certain cooking methods can also contribute to pesticide reduction, primarily through breakdown or evaporation.

  • Blanching and Boiling:
    • Concrete Example: Blanching green beans or boiling potatoes before mashing can help reduce some heat-sensitive pesticides. The residues may leach into the cooking water.

    • Actionable Explanation: While some nutrients can also leach into the water, for high-pesticide-risk items, this can be a beneficial trade-off. Discard the cooking water after use.

  • Steaming:

    • Concrete Example: Steaming vegetables like broccoli or asparagus can also reduce some pesticide levels, as the heat can cause certain chemicals to volatilize.

    • Actionable Explanation: Steaming generally retains more nutrients than boiling while still offering some pesticide reduction benefits.

Meat, Poultry, and Dairy: The Feed Factor

Pesticides used on animal feed crops (like corn, soy, and alfalfa) can accumulate in animal tissues and products.

  • Concrete Example: Conventionally raised cattle, chickens, and dairy cows consume feed that may contain pesticide residues. These can then be stored in their fat and milk.

  • Actionable Explanation: Choose organic, grass-fed, or pasture-raised meat, poultry, and dairy products whenever possible. These animals are typically fed organic feed and have greater access to outdoor foraging, reducing their exposure to conventional pesticides. Look for certifications like “USDA Organic” or “Certified Grassfed.”

Processed Foods: Hidden Sources

Processed foods, especially those containing conventional corn, soy, or wheat derivatives, can contain pesticide residues from their raw ingredients.

  • Concrete Example: Many breakfast cereals, snack bars, and processed baked goods contain corn syrup, soy lecithin, or conventional wheat flour.

  • Actionable Explanation: Read ingredient labels carefully. Prioritize products made with organic ingredients, especially for staples like flour, oils, and sweeteners. Opt for whole, unprocessed foods as the cornerstone of your diet to minimize exposure from these hidden sources.

Water Quality: An Often-Overlooked Element

Pesticides can leach into groundwater and surface water, potentially contaminating drinking water supplies.

  • Concrete Example: Runoff from agricultural fields can carry pesticides into rivers, lakes, and ultimately, public water systems.

  • Actionable Explanation: Consider investing in a high-quality water filter for your tap water. Look for filters certified to remove a range of contaminants, including pesticides. Reverse osmosis or activated carbon filters are generally effective.
